2013-10-10 2 views
-1

Excel로 내 텍스트 데이터를 양식으로 전송하여 제출하고 싶습니다. 이 작업을 수행하는 데 많은 시간이 필요합니다. 그래서 나는 나를 위해이 일을 할 수있는 자동화 도구를 찾고있다.웹 페이지의 텍스트 필드와 버튼으로 데이터를 전송합니다.

기본적으로이 웹 페이지는 텍스트 입력란과 버튼으로 구성됩니다.

텍스트 필드의 태그 이름과 버튼의 Excel을 사용하여 텍스트 필드를 채우고 버튼을 클릭 할 수있는 방법이 있습니까?

+0

올바른 정보를 추가하고 가능하면 jsfiddle을 추가하십시오. 그렇지 않으면 엑셀에서 양식에 액세스하는 데 필요한 옵션이 Ctrl + C와 Ctrl + V 인 경우 – Anup

+0

ctrl + c 및 ctrl + v를 다시 보내 주셔서 감사합니다. 나는 다른 방법으로 웹 페이지에 수동으로 데이터를 입력하는 다른 수단이 있는지 물었다. – user2351447

답변

0

본인 용 또는 웹 배포 용입니까?

자신이 원하는 경우 Excel 파일을 CSV로 저장할 수 있습니다. 그런 다음 JS가 이해할 수있는 것으로 처리하는 방법을 찾을 수 있어야합니다.

실제로 텍스트 요소의 값을 설정하는 것은 단순히 요소를 대상으로 지정하고 value = someValue로 설정하면됩니다. 예를 들면 다음과 같이 할 수 있습니다.

var t = document.getElementById("firstTextField") 
t.value = "someValue" 

jQuery를 사용할 수도 있습니다.

+0

:이 사이트는 다른 사람들이 배포했습니다. 의견을 보내 주셔서 감사합니다. – user2351447

0

브라우저를 전혀 사용할 필요가 없습니다. 브라우저와 Excel은 기본 데이터 및 API 정의의 맨 위에있는 UI이므로이를 스크립트로 작성할 수 있습니다. 일반적인 아이디어 :

  1. 제출하려는 양식을 검사하십시오. 대상, 제출 방법 및 필드 이름을 찾습니다.
  2. 엑셀 파일을 CSV로 내 보냅니다.
  3. 간단한 스크립트를 작성하여 각 레코드를 반복하고 양식 제출과 일치하는 HTTP 요청 (동일한 HTTP 메소드, 동일한 대상 URL, 적절한 입력 이름 아래에 Excel 값 넣기)을 작성하십시오.

제공하신 정보가 더 구체적이지 않습니다.

관련 문제